Pool Patio Repair in West Des Moines, IA
Pool patio rep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the outdoor surfaces surrounding a swimming pool area. This includes fixing cracked or uneven concrete, replacing damaged pavers, repairing or replacing decking materials, and addressing drainage issues that can impact safety and usability. Property owners often seek these services to improve the appearance of their pool area, ensure safety, and extend the lifespan of existing patio structures, especially after weather-related damage or general wear over time. Before requesting repairs, homeowners should consider the scope of the project, including the extent of damage, the materials involved, and any aesthetic preferences to ensure the repairs meet their needs.
Understanding the specific repairs needed and the overall condition of the pool patio is essential for property owners. They should evaluate whether only minor cracks or surface issues require attention or if more extensive work, such as replacing large sections of decking or addressing foundational concerns, is necessary. Additionally, considerations about material compatibility, drainage solutions, and the desired final appearance can help in planning a successful repair project. Clear communication of these details can assist in obtaining accurate assessments and effective repair solutions tailored to the property's outdoor space.

Common Pool Patio Repair Jobs
Pool deck repair - restores damaged or cracked concrete around the pool area.
Surface resurfacing - refreshes worn or stained pool patios for a like-new appearance.
Crack sealing - prevents further damage by sealing small cracks before they worsen.
Slab replacement - replaces severely damaged or unstable sections of the pool patio.
Drainage correction - improves water flow to prevent pooling and erosion around the pool area.
Surface leveling - ensures a smooth, even surface for safety and aesthetic appeal.
Pool Patio Repair Questions
What types of damage can occur to a pool patio? Common issues include cracking, surface discoloration, and loose or broken tiles that may need repair or resurfacing.
How can I tell if my pool patio needs repair? Signs include uneven surfaces, visible cracks, loose stones, or water pooling around the edges.
What are common repair options for pool patios? Repairs may involve patching cracks, replacing damaged tiles, or resurfacing the entire area for a fresh look.
Will repairs improve the safety of my pool area? Yes, fixing uneven surfaces and loose tiles can help prevent trips and falls around the pool.
